Sweet Chili Chicken Recipe

Description

Sweet Chili Chicken is a quick and flavorful stir-fry featuring tender chicken pieces coated in a sweet and spicy chili sauce, combined with colorful vegetables for a satisfying meal. Perfect for busy weeknights, this dish balances heat, sweetness, and savory flavors all in one skillet.


Ingredients

For the Chicken Marinade

  • 1/2 cup sweet chili sauce
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ch

For the Chicken and Vegetables

  • 1 pound ch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on minced garlic
  • 1 teaspoon minced ginger
  • 1 b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 cup broccoli florets

Garnishes

  • Sesame seeds (for garnish)
  • Green onions, sliced (for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Marinate Chicken: In a bowl, combine sweet chili sauce, soy sauce, and cornstarch. Add the chicken pieces and toss to coat evenly. Let marinate for 15 minutes to absorb flavors.
  2. Cook Chicken: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the marinated chicken and cook, stirring occasionally, until browned and cooked through, approximately 7-10 minutes. Remove chicken from skillet and set aside.
  3. Sauté Vegetables: In the same skillet, add garlic and ginger, cooking for about 30 seconds until fragrant. Add sliced bell pepper and broccoli florets. Sauté for 5-7 minutes until vegetables are tender-crisp.
  4. Combine and Heat: Return the cooked chicken to the skillet with vegetables. Pour any remaining marinade over the mixture and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until heated through and well coated.
  5. Serve: Garnish with sesame seeds and sliced green onions. Serve hot, ideally over rice or noodles for a complete meal.

Notes

  • Adjust the sweetness by adding more or less sweet chili sauce according to your taste.
  • Serve over rice or noodles for a more filling meal.
  • You can add additional vegetables like snap peas or carrots for variety.
